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ll send a team of experienced technicians to assess the extent of the water damage and create a customized plan for extraction and restoration. This includes identifying the source of the leak, assessing the affected areas, and developing a timeline for completion.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our team will use advanced equipment, including truck-mounted extractors and portable pumps, to remove standing water from your office building. This process typically takes 2-3 hours,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use industrial-grade drying equipment to remove moisture from the affected areas. This includes air movers, dehumidifiers, and thermal imaging cameras to ensure that every area is dry and safe.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ning

After the drying process is complete, our team will sanitize and clean the affected areas to prevent mold growth and bacterial contamination. This includes using eco-friendly cleaning products and equipment to ensure a safe and healthy environment.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Certification

Once the restoration process is complete, we’ll conduct a thorough inspection to ensure that your office building is safe and secure. We’ll also provide you with a certification of completion, which includes a detailed report of the work performed and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Warning Signs You Need Office Building Water Extraction

Water damage can be sneaky, but there are often warning signs that show you need professional help. Here are a few things to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show mold growth or bacterial contamination. If you notice persistent musty smells in your office building, it’s time to call us.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a larger problem, including roof leaks, burst pipes, or foundation issues. Don’t ignore these signs, call us to assess the damage and provide a solution.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or uneven moisture levels. This can be a sign of a larger issue, including foundation problems or poor drainage.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ds, such as dripping water or creaking pipes, can show a leak or other issue. If you notice any unusual sounds or leaks, don’t hesitate to call us.

Visible Water Damage or Leaks

Visible water damage or leaks can be a sign of a serious issue, including roof leaks, burst pipes, or foundation problems. Call us immediately to assess the damage and provide a solution.

Office Building Water Extraction Cost in Kingsburg, CA

The cost of office building water extraction in Kingsburg, CA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ions
Sanitizing and cleaning $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and type of cleaning products used
Dehumidification and drying equipment rental $100 – $500 Size of affected area and rental duration
Final inspection and certification $100 – $300 Complexity of the job and type of certification required
Emergency response and assessment $200 – $1,000 Severity of the emergency and complexity of the assessment
